The Santa Clara County Central Fire Protection District, also known as the Santa Clara County Fire Department, is a special district. It provides firefighting and emergency medical services in much of unincorporated Santa Clara County. Its service area includes Cupertino, Los Gatos, Monte Sereno, parts of Saratoga, and, starting July 1, 2025, areas previously served by the South Santa Clara County Fire District. These areas include San Martin and unincorporated regions near Morgan Hill and Gilroy. The district also serves Campbell, Los Altos, and other areas through service contracts.
The Central Fire Protection District is not part of the Santa Clara County government. It operates as a separate legal entity. Its staff are not county employees. The district is mainly funded by property taxes and service contracts. It does not receive money from the County General Fund or other county sources.
The County Board of Supervisors oversees the district and acts as its board of directors. The Board approves the district’s budget. The fire chief is appointed by the Board and reports to County Executive James R. Williams. For the 2025-26 fiscal year, the district’s budget is $184.2 million.
